Nestled in the Austrian Alps, Lilienfeld ski resort is perfect for families and beginners. The resort features a mix of gentle slopes and challenging runs, ensuring everyone can enjoy the snow.

The ski area of Lilienfeld is in the Austrian Alps at an altitude of 380m, with 11km of marked runs.

Lilienfeld has direct access to 11km of downhill skiing, with 4 marked pistes, served by a total of 2 ski lifts.

The skiing is at relatively low altitude, so snow cover can be variable.

How to get there

 By Air

The nearest airport to Lilienfeld is Vienna, 78 minutes drive away.

Linz, Bratislava, Graz, Brno and Salzburg airports are all within three hours drive.

Lilienfeld is easily accessible from Vienna, approximately 80 kilometers away, via the A1 motorway. Public transport options include convenient train services from Vienna to the nearby town of Lilienfeld.

Infrastructure

Ski Lift Capacity

The two ski lifts are able to uplift 1,000 skiers and snowboarders every hour.

Snow Making

Snow-making is available, on 5km of ski runs, with 15 snow cannons.
